A speech and language podcast to motivate and inspire school-based SLPs. Get the tips, strategies, and low-prep therapy ideas you need to confidently walk into your therapy room and plan with ease. Learn and hear stories from an SLP in the trenches just like you!

Frequently Asked Questions About SLP Coffee Talk

What is SLP Coffee Talk about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Aimed primarily at school-based Speech-Language Pathologists (SLPs), the content emphasizes practical strategies and resources designed to increase efficiency and effectiveness within therapy environments. Episodes often tackle themes such as caseload management, effective IEP writing, self-care strategies for practitioners, and techniques for working with diverse student needs, including those with developmental language disorders or visual impairments. The relatable insights shared by both the host and expert guests offer listeners actionable advice to enhance their practice and promote student success.
